I'm trying to get USB CDC to work on an ESP32S2.
If we delay the main of our program (basically a sleep in the first line), then the device correctly enumerates and is detected. If we don't then things go bad: the USB uart doesn't work and the program doesn't run. Since I don't have access to the logs at that point I don't know if there are crashes or other problems.
On my Linux machine I have output that is similar to the following:
Code: Select all
[498355.059862] cdc_acm 5-2.2:1.0: ttyACM0: USB ACM device
[498355.067022] usb 5-2.2: USB disconnect, device number 71
[498355.717746] usb 5-2.2: new full-speed USB device number 72 using xhci_hcd
[498356.302995] usb 5-2.2: device descriptor read/64, error -32
[498374.320576] usb 5-2.2: unable to read config index 0 descriptor/all
[498374.320594] usb 5-2.2: can't read configurations, error -110

Is there an easy way to see what goes wrong?
Note that the problem is not dependent on the host computer. Even without any USB-connection, our program will never connect to the WiFi. If we disable CDC in the skdconfig, it works without issues.
Edit: we are currently using esp-idf 5.3.1.
